GENERAL FUNCTION: The K7 Stacker is responsible for assisting the Operator and assistant will all activities associated with running the rotarty die cutters including setup, operation, cleanup, and recommending improvements to operations.
- Responsible for running the pre-feeder effectively and not allowing the machine to stop
- Performs incoming inspection ahead of time to ensure material is adequate for running. Caliper/ Warp/ Size, etc.
- Keeps tags from units to ensure we have consumed all units correctly
- Makes load tags for operator
- Orders pallets for jobs to be ran
- Gathers proper dunnage for operator
- Assists with setting up print and die cut sections of die cutters accurately in accordance with proper setup techniques
- Ensures all bolts on cutting dies are in place and tighly secured
- Understands the zero position of the cutting die section as well as the printing units
- Inspects anilox rolls for damage , before and after proper training
- Understands and Performs a one box set up
- Inspects all dies before and after each run to ensure that any necessary repairs are made before the next run
- Monitors box quality, including but not limited to lose liner,warp, correct size, and print throughout the run
- Achieves 100,000msf per hour on thru run
- Maximizes the utilization of equipment by operating the machinery at available capacity and speed
- Assists with necessary report in an accurate and timely manner, including but not limited to Production, Data, Machine Operational Status, waste, downtime Safety Data, Quality Data
- Assists Operator with maintenance work orders to Supervision for needed repairs
- Interacts with the ink technician to find optimal color sequence and color matching
- Performs other related duties as needed

- While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to stand, walk, talk and hear. The employee is required to stand for long periods of time go up/down step ladders, stairs and elevating platforms. The employee frequently is required to use their hands and arms, and st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l. The employee must be able to perform repetitive motions and must have strong finger dexterity.
- The employee must regularly lift and/or move up to 50 pounds and occasionally lift and/or move up to 100 pounds utilizing the buddy system. Specific vision abilities required for this job include close, distance, peripheral and color vision, depth perception, and ability to adjust focus.
- While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ly exposed to moving mechanical parts. The employee is frequently exposed to wet and/or humid conditions. The employee is occasionally exposed to high, precarious places; fumes or airborne particles; and vibration. The noise level in the work environment is usually loud. The employee works around powered industrial trucks, heavy objects, conveyor systems, and machines including highly energized systems such as pneumatic and electrical systems. The employee works with chemicals, high heat items, and sharp objects. The employee uses pneumatic systems including air and water hoses. The employee must be able to adapt to a changing work environment.
